Features of the Schmincke HORADAM 74424 Watercolors

• Watercolor set of 24 half pans

• Metal case of 22.3 cm long x 7.2 cm wide x 2.3 cm high

• Includes built-in palette for mixing

According to the transparency of the colors, the set consists of: 10 semi-transparent colors, 8 semi-opaque colors and 6 opaque colors.

According to the lightfastness, the set consists of: 1 with limited lightfastness (2 stars), 4 with lightfastness (3 stars), 14 with good lightfastness (4 stars) and 5 with extreme lightfastness (5 stars)

According to the staining or tinting of the colors, the set consists of: 1 has little staining, 16 are semi-staining and 7 have staining.

Colors included in the set: lemon yellow 215, cadmium yellow light 224, chrom. yellow deep 213, chromium orange hue 214, cadmium red light 349, perylene maroon 366, permanent carmine 353, magenta 352, manganese violet 474, indigo 485, ultramarine finest 494, prussian blue 492, helio cerulean 479, helio turquoise 475, phthalo green 519, may green 524, cobalt green dark 533, permanent green olive 534, naples yellow 229, yellow ochre 655, burnt sienna 661, english venetian red 649, sepia brown 663, ivory black 780.

Advantages of the Schmincke HORADAM 74424 Watercolors

The Schmincke HORADAM paints are a guarantee of quality “Made in Germany”

Easy color selection

Nature as a source of inspiration, the desire of customers and the chemistry of color, are the starting points of Horadam’s colorists to develop the colors, obtaining as many colors as possible from the same pigment, making it easier for you to select colors for your work.

New and optimized colors

The wide selection of Horadam watercolors offers you 140 intense colors of which 35 are new and 4 are optimized, mixed with Oxgall as a natural wetting agent to facilitate the flow of paint on paper.

New pigments

The expanded range of Horadam colors is due to the study and research of 20 new pigments such as quinacridone, perylene and transparent iron oxides.

Higher performance

The paint is poured 4 times in liquid state into the pans or reservoirs to obtain higher performance.

Quality of the Gum Arabic

Gum arabic specially selected as a natural binder and also ox gall.

Reusable paint

You can reuse the paint after it dries on the palette.

Paint flow control

Most of the paints are not granulating and you can control the paint flow very well even on soft papers.

Although in the set there are 2 granulating colors (a natural property of certain pigments): manganese violet and cobalt green dark, (identified with the letter G) you can use them consciously to create special effects.

The same recipe

The formula of the colors is the same for pans and tubes, that is, you can get the same colors from the pans in paint tubes of 5 ml and 15 ml, plus you can buy the pans or godets separately in half pan or full pan.

New colors

The Schmincke HORADAM 74424 watercolor set incorporates several new and unique colors such as:

Perylene Maroon 366, from Quinacridone, this is a highly lightfast pigment, Ultramarine Finest 494, from Perylenes, which is completely new and also highly lightfast, Yellow Ochre 655, Burnt Sienna 661, from transparent iron oxides, these two transparent colors are rare due to the hardness and difficulty of processing these pigments.

Winsor & Newton

Winsor & Newton

Winsor & Newton, founded in London in 1832, is one of the earliest and most well-known brands to produce watercolor pans. It has a long tradition of manufacturing art materials and is known for its commitment to quality and innovation.

The brand is known for its high quality and wide range of vibrant and bright colors. It is also famous for the durability of its pigments and its smooth and creamy consistency.

Winsor & Newton watercolors are made using high-quality pigments, which are carefully selected and subjected to rigorous quality controls to ensure their purity and consistency.

Another distinctive feature of Winsor & Newton watercolors is their wide range of colors and tones. The brand offers over 100 different colors in its line of watercolor pans, allowing artists to create a wide variety of effects and styles in their works.

In addition, Winsor & Newton is known for its “professional series” watercolors, which use high-quality pigments and offer excellent transparency, color saturation, and lightfastness. These watercolors are commonly used in professional and exhibition works.

Finally, Winsor & Newton also offers a line of “student series” watercolor pans that are more affordable but still maintain good quality. These watercolors are ideal for beginner artists or those looking to experiment with watercolors without spending too much money.


Schmincke

Schmincke

Schmincke is another pioneer brand in the production of watercolor pans, established in Germany in 1881.

It is known for its wide selection of colors and high pigment concentration, making its watercolors very vibrant and luminous. Additionally, its watercolors are characterized by their ease of use and uniform blending.

An important feature that sets Schmincke watercolors apart from other brands of watercolor pans is their high concentration of high-quality pigments. Schmincke uses a significantly larger amount of pure pigments in its watercolors, resulting in greater color saturation, brightness, and depth.

Another distinctive feature of Schmincke watercolors is its wide range of colors. The brand offers over 140 different colors in its line of watercolor pans.

The brand carefully selects and rigorously tests its pigments to ensure their consistency and purity.

It also uses a hot pressing technique that ensures the pigments blend uniformly and the watercolor pans are more resistant to cracking.

Finally, Schmincke is a German brand with a long tradition of producing high-quality art materials, ensuring that its watercolors are consistently valued and used by professional and amateur artists worldwide.

M. Graham

M. Graham

The M. Graham watercolor brand was founded in 1996 in the state of Oregon, United States, by artists James and Vicky Graham. The Grahams wanted to create a line of high-quality watercolors that stood out from existing brands, and to achieve this, they decided to use honey as a key ingredient in their formula.

M. Graham watercolors are characterized by their high pigment concentration and excellent blending ability. In addition, the honey used in the formula of M. Graham watercolors gives them exceptional shine and transparency, making them very popular among watercolor artists.

Honey is a natural ingredient that acts as a binder in the manufacture of watercolors. When used in the manufacture of watercolors, honey helps to maintain the moisture and softness of the paint, allowing for better dissolution in water and easier use.

Instead of using gum arabic or other synthetic binders commonly used in watercolor manufacturing, M. Graham uses pure and natural bee honey as a binder.

Bee honey is a natural ingredient that has adhesive and stabilizing properties, meaning it helps to keep the pigments of the watercolors together and keeps them moist for longer on the artist’s palette. Additionally, honey helps to create a smooth and creamy texture in the paint, making it easier to mix and apply to paper.

The use of honey as a binder is a distinctive feature of M. Graham watercolors, and is one of the reasons why many artists prefer this brand of watercolors. The honey used in M. Graham watercolors comes from local bees and is processed at the company’s factory in Oregon, United States.
